Understanding the Fresnel Lens
The key to the distinctive look of this type of trim lies in the Fresnel lens. This lens, characterized by its concentric rings, not only directs light efficiently but also adds a subtle texture and visual interest to the ceiling. This design is a departure from the typical smooth surface of standard trims, offering a more refined and sophisticated aesthetic.

Commonly Asked Questions About Progress Recessed Fresnel Trim
Q: What is a Fresnel lens in recessed lighting, and what benefits does it offer?
A: A Fresnel lens in recessed lighting, specifically within the trim, uses a series of concentric rings to focus and direct the light. This design creates a controlled, soft-edged beam that minimizes glare and enhances the ambiance of a room, offering a more sophisticated and comfortable lighting experience.
